M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
discusses
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ning technology enable
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online courses.
These massive online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
online learning technology institutions
are struggling with
now that lear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
How can teachers
assure that
the schooling provided by these
MOOC courses is
satisfactory?
How can we
certify that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ach classes online?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Ireland to conduct these massively open online courses?
What experimental teaching practices and evaluation strategies are in use today?
How can we
handle problems like
low
student motivation and high
learner attrition?
The ultimate purpose of massive open online courses is to provide education to more people all around the world.
